The Brita Plus Water Filter is a high-density, BPA-free replacement filter that traps twice as many contaminants as standard Brita filters, including chlorine, copper, and cadmium. Each filter lasts approximately two months or 40 gallons, fitting all Brita pitchers and dispensers except Stream. By replacing up to 300 single-use plastic bottles per filter, it offers a sustainable, eco-friendly solution for great tasting, fresh water backed by NSF certification and the trusted Brita brand.
